    Re: Meditation anyone?

    Since Christmas I've started listening to some meditations at night when I go to bed, because my thoughts race and I have a lot of difficulty sleeping. I've found it's amazing. I have a 20-minute one and I haven't heard the end of it yet because I fall asleep!

    Mine is an iPhone app. There are many free "lite" versions you can try out before investing in the full versions that offer a selection of meditations.

    There are also many meditation podcasts that you can download and try free of charge to try out.

    It works brilliantly for my purposes, and I think that any kind of relaxation exercise should help a lot with anxiety because it just slows your thoughts down. I'd recommend trying iTunes to get free ones to try out different styles before spending any money.
